Import multiple Manufacturers from Google Sheets to Shopware 6

该工作流旨在将制造商信息从Google Sheets自动导入至Shopware 6电商平台,支持多语言翻译和Logo上传,简化批量管理流程。通过OAuth2认证保障数据安全,并使用自定义代码节点灵活构建请求,提高了导入的效率和准确性。适用于电商运营人员和IT自动化工程师,帮助企业快速实现数据同步,降低人为错误,提升工作效率。

流程图
Import multiple Manufacturers from Google Sheets to Shopware 6 工作流程图

工作流名称

Import multiple Manufacturers from Google Sheets to Shopware 6

主要功能和亮点

本工作流实现了将多个制造商信息从Google Sheets自动导入到Shopware 6电商平台的功能。支持多语言翻译字段的处理以及制造商Logo的自动上传,极大简化了制造商数据批量管理流程。工作流采用OAuth2认证保障数据安全,且通过代码节点灵活构建导入请求体,兼顾了高度定制化和自动化。

解决的核心问题

  • 手工录入制造商信息繁琐且容易出错
  • 多语言制造商信息管理复杂
  • 制造商Logo上传流程分散,效率低下
  • 需要统一且自动化的制造商数据同步方案

应用场景

  • 电子商务平台批量导入及维护制造商数据
  • 多语言电商环境下制造商信息的统一管理
  • 需要将外部表格数据(Google Sheets)无缝同步至Shopware 6的企业
  • 快速搭建制造商信息导入自动化流程,减少人工干预

主要流程步骤

  1. 手动触发工作流开始执行
  2. 设置Shopware 6访问URL和默认语言参数
  3. 从指定Google Sheets表格读取制造商信息,包括名称、官网、描述及多语言翻译字段
  4. 使用自定义代码节点生成Shopware所需的导入请求体,支持多语言翻译和Logo标识的MD5生成
  5. 逐条遍历制造商数据,调用Shopware同步API批量导入制造商记录
  6. 判断是否存在Logo链接,若有则调用Shopware媒体上传接口完成Logo上传
  7. 循环处理所有制造商条目,确保数据和Logo均被成功导入

涉及的系统或服务

  • Google Sheets:作为制造商基础数据的来源
  • Shopware 6:电商平台,接收制造商数据和Logo上传
  • OAuth2 API认证:保障Shopware接口调用的安全性
  • n8n自动化平台:构建和执行整个工作流
  • 自定义代码节点:处理复杂数据转换和请求体构建

适用人群或使用价值

  • 电商运营人员:简化制造商数据管理,提升工作效率
  • IT自动化工程师:快速搭建Shopware数据导入自动化解决方案
  • 多语言电商平台管理者:便捷维护多语言制造商信息
  • 企业管理层:降低人为错误,确保数据准确一致
  • 任何希望将Google Sheets数据无缝同步至Shopware 6制造商模块的用户

该工作流显著提升了制造商数据导入的自动化和准确性,帮助企业节省大量时间和人力成本,实现数据管理现代化。